I wish to have a playlist editor similar to iTunes or media player which creates playlists within a grid and can save and retrieve them as XML documents. The editor must be written in c#. The playlist is meant to be distributed to many computers, all of which will play all the item in this except those specifically excluded from a dropdown that appears on each grid line (see screenshots) The editor will use a folder/file explorer as its source of playlist items using the Sky Software FileView control [login to view URL] It will be possible to drag and drop an item or several items onto a grid. Once in the grid it should be possible to drag and drop/copy/delete/insert items within the grid. I would also like to undo and redo the last operations on the grid. The grid will show the full path of the files dragged onto it, allow a duration to be entered into one of the cells and allows the computer exclusions to be chose using a drop down combo in the grid (see screen shot). For now the list of computers can be hard coded. Another drop down allows an "appear" transtion effect to be added. These can be hardcoded also for now. The program will save the playlist using the attached XML grammar. The playlist ID which is on the document element of the document is generated when the playlist is created but is retained when the list is opened and edited. The other IDs can be ignored - the exclusions are the ids of records dropped down in the "applies to zone" dropdown. YOu can use whatever you like as the id here (the computername would be fine!).
